    About the Course
    This honours degree programme prepares students for a career in accounting and finance. The course subjects are taught by highly qualified lecturing staff who are also experienced accountants. Their continued experience of accounting and finance, in the real commercial world, ensures the delivery of a relevant and up to date syllabus that will include interesting and pertinent case studies. In particular, students will study the impact of EU Law on accountancy.

    In first year students take subjects that are common to the BA (Hons) in Business Studies. This model gives students the flexibility to adjust their career choices if necessary.

    Once completed you will have all the necessary skills to pursue a dynamic and rewarding career in accounting and finance. As someone who is interested in the relationship between numbers and success this may only be the first stage of your journey as other opportunities will present themselves.

    As with the BA (Hons) in Business Studies, the college designed this degree programme with the help and considerable expertise of its full-time and external lecturing staff, as well as a wide range of people in industry. As a result, the programme reflects the multiple requirements of today's business and finance world.

    Careers
    While typical careers focus on the world of finance and accounting in particular, any aspect of the business arena is open to graduates. A significant advantage is the many exemptions from the professional exams for which graduates of the course are eligible. Students who do not wish to focus on a career as an accountant will find numerous opportunities in banking, stockbroking, currency trading, management, insurance or any career in the financial sector.

    BA (Hons) in Accounting and Finance Course Content

    Year 1
    Business Communications
    Information Technology
    Business Economics
    Financial Accounting 1
    Organisational Management
    Business Mathematics and Statistics
    Applied Business Law
    Principles of Marketing
    Financial Accounting 2
    Integrated Business Project

    Year 2
    Management Accounting
    Financial Reporting - Concepts and Practice
    Business Management
    Managing Human Resources
    Financial Management
    Business Information Systems
    Company Law/Partnership Law
    Enterprise Development/Project

    Year 3
    Strategic Management
    Taxation
    Advanced Financial Reporting
    Auditing and Internal Review
    Advanced Management Accounting
    Strategic Financial Management
    Information Systems Management
    Business Plan/Dissertation

  • Cost in US$:

    Approx. 40,000 USD tuition only for full degree (3 years)

  • Program Fees Include:

    Price includes tuition only for the full degree (3 years). Students can expect to spend in addition approximately 10,000 USD or more per year on personal and living expenses.
